Mumbai: Tata Communications has officially appointed N Ganapathy Subramaniam (NGS) as the Chairman of its Board of Directors. His appointment follows the recommendation of the Nomination and Remuneration Committee, as stated in the company’s regulatory filing.
NGS, a veteran of the Tata Group, has been a pivotal figure in the growth of Tata Consultancy Services (TCS) over the past four decades. Before stepping down in May 2024, he served as the Chief Operating Officer (COO) and Executive Director at TCS, where he was instrumental in driving global operations and digital transformation initiatives. His leadership contributed significantly to TCS’s emergence as a global IT powerhouse.
Following his departure from TCS, NGS has continued to hold key positions within the Tata Group. He currently serves as the Chairman and Non-Executive Director at Tata Elxsi and Tejas Networks Limited, in addition to being a board member of multiple Tata Group companies.
